> Here's my snippet of music (much delete because the code works fine).  I
> would like to put a fermata over the repeat.  The repeat bar in this case
> will appear in the middle of measure.  I understand how to get it at the
> end of a measure but not over a bar in the that occurs in the measure.

Hi,

Like for "normal" barline,
  \mark \markup { \musicglyph #"scripts.ufermata" }
works well and align on the repeat bar even if it occurs in the middle
of a measure.
Simply put this at the end of your  \repeat volta  (either before or
after the closing brace, it's the same).
